Transaction 856838580a21ef43d39e34e71f3c92ffca7ade77c12dd206fcad3cf5d0c4dc4a

1 Input
2 Outputs
  • 856838580a21ef43d39e34e71f3c92ffca7ade77c12dd206fcad3cf5d0c4dc4a:0
  • value  2058182
    address  bc1qx4kscrzcc84frg2da22s2tcgws8m450xeeejeq
  • 856838580a21ef43d39e34e71f3c92ffca7ade77c12dd206fcad3cf5d0c4dc4a:1
  • value  4815195
    address  bc1qaav0zlgh9tqcu6rsp9l8de20aljtyl2l5r9jcz